Advanced Alloy Composition

Utilizing premium alloy compositions for optimal corrosion resistance and weldability.

  • High Chromium Content: Enhances corrosion resistance.
  • Molybdenum Addition: Improves pit corrosion resistance.
  • Controlled Carbon Level: Optimizes weldability and ductility.

Stainless Steel Welding Electrode Specifications

Detailed specifications for various electrode types and sizes.

Electrode Type Diameter (mm) Tensile Strength (MPa) AWS Classification Welding Position Typical Applications
E308L-16 2.4 550-650 AWS A5.4 All Positions General Fabrication, Piping
E309L-15 3.2 500-600 AWS A5.4 Flat & Horizontal Dissimilar Metal Welding
E316L-16 2.4 580-680 AWS A5.4 All Positions Chemical Processing, Marine
E347-16 3.2 520-620 AWS A5.4 All Positions High-Temperature Applications
E320LR-16 2.4 530-630 AWS A5.4 All Positions Cryogenic Applications
E307-16 3.2 510-610 AWS A5.4 All Positions Cladding Applications

What are stainless steel welding electrodes?

Stainless steel welding electrodes are consumables used to join stainless steel materials through welding. They consist of a metal wire covered with a flux coating that provides shielding gas and stabilizes the arc.

2

What are the benefits of using stainless steel electrodes?

Stainless steel electrodes offer excellent corrosion resistance, high strength, and durability, making them ideal for a wide range of applications in demanding environments.
